Understanding Parasite SEO

At its core, parasite SEO involves publishing content on high-authority platforms that allow user-generated submissions. By doing so, individuals or businesses can leverage the trust and authority of these sites to rank higher in search results. Common platforms include Medium, LinkedIn, Quora, and various forums that accept contributions. The allure lies in how quickly one can achieve visibility without needing a fully developed website.

However, this approach carries inherent risks. Search engines are becoming increasingly adept at recognizing manipulative techniques. If a site gets flagged for spammy behavior or low-quality content, it can lead to penalties — not just for the host but for those using the platform as well. Consequently, understanding which platforms are reliable and how long they remain trustworthy is crucial.

Evaluating Platform Trustworthiness

Not all platforms are equal when it comes to sustainability or reliability in hosting parasite content. Certain sites tend to outlast others due to their robust content moderation policies or user engagement structures.

Identifying which sites will endure requires some research:

    Content Moderation Policies: Review how strictly a platform enforces its content rules. Sites with rigorous moderation often maintain higher quality standards. Historical Performance: Look at the longevity of accounts on these platforms; those with a history of stable operations generally indicate lower deletion risks. User Feedback: Active discussions within communities about specific platforms can reveal their reputations regarding trustworthiness and penalty risks.

For example, Medium has proven resilient over time for many users; however, it has also been subject to shifts in editorial policies that could affect your content's visibility. Understanding these nuances helps mitigate risks associated with sudden account bans or deletions.
